Abstract
A dual ultra-clean corn thresher belongs to the agricultural machinery field for solving the problem of incomplete threshing of the present threshers. The utility model provides a dual ultra-clean corn thresher with an addition of a dual threshing mechanism on an original thresher to achieve complete mechanization, wherein an assistant thresher is equipped laterally on a master thresher which communicates with the assistant thresher through a master impurities outlet. An assistant roller is equipped in the assistant thresher, and spike-teeth are equipped on the assistant roller wherein the assistant roller axle concentrically connected with a master roller axle in the master thresher. The bottom of the shell of the assistant thresher is an assistant roller deck whose bottom is equipped with a slide board, and a small boult corresponding to the impurity outlet on the assistant thresher is equipped near the assistant thresher. The utility model has the advantages of simple conformation, convenient employment, high production rate, high threshing quality and low cracking rate.
Description
Technical field:
The utility model belongs to agricultural mechanical field.
Background technology:
At present; the thresher that sale and peasant use on the market is of a great variety; its structure also has nothing in common with each other; yet; it is not thorough that these threshing ubiquities threshing; in threshing course, most seed is taken off and collected; and because the limitation of machine itself; in order not remain the seed waste, just have to take off unclean seed by manually collecting with remaining, strengthened peasant's working strength virtually; great amount of manpower and time have been wasted; make threshing work become the front portion and be divided into mechanization, the rear section is artificialization, so do not reach the standard of full mechanization.
Technology contents:
In order to address the above problem, the utility model is provided at additional secondary thresher machine on original thresher, thereby reaches the compound ultra-clean husker sheller of full mechanization.
The utility model is by main thresher; charging aperture on the main thresher; main drum shaft in the main thresher; compositions such as the riddle of main thresher lower end and blower fan; side at main thresher is equipped with auxiliary thresher; communicate by main impurity discharging port between main thresher and auxiliary thresher; auxiliary cylinder is installed in auxiliary thresher; spike-tooth is installed on auxiliary cylinder; and auxiliary roller axis in the auxiliary cylinder and interior coaxial concentric connection of main drum shaft of main thresher; the housing lower end of auxiliary thresher is the auxiliary cylinder notch board; in auxiliary cylinder notch board lower end slide plate is installed, the next door of auxiliary thresher have with auxiliary thresher on the corresponding sifter of impurity discharging port.
The utility model is simple in structure, and is easy to use, and the productivity ratio height, the threshing quality is good, percentage of damage is low.On the basis of an original threshing; carried out the secondary threshing again; make whole threshing course cleaner; more thorough; reduced the waste in threshing course; and also having reduced the unnecessary manpower of waste in threshing course accordingly, reduced threshing personnel's working strength, is the efficient ultra-clean of a kind of saving of labor, compound husker sheller.

Embodiment:
The utility model is by main thresher 3; charging aperture 1 on the main thresher 3; main drum shaft 2 in the main thresher 3; compositions such as the riddle 13 of main thresher 3 lower ends and blower fan 14; in the side of main thresher 3 auxiliary thresher 5 is installed; 5 of main thresher 3 and auxiliary threshers communicate by main impurity discharging port 4; carry out the secondary threshing in the auxiliary thresher 5 through assorted surplus entering into after main thresher 3 threshings by main impurity discharging port 4; auxiliary cylinder 6 is installed in auxiliary thresher 5; spike-tooth 9 is installed on auxiliary cylinder 6; and 2 coaxial concentric connections of main drum shaft that the auxiliary roller axis 8 in the auxiliary cylinder 6 and main thresher 3 are interior; also just be exactly when main drum shaft 2 drives the master rotor rotation; auxiliary roller axis 8 drives auxiliary cylinder 6 simultaneously and rotates simultaneously; the housing lower end of auxiliary thresher 6 is auxiliary cylinder notch boards 12; in auxiliary cylinder notch board 12 lower ends slide plate 11 is installed; slide plate 11 is inclined slope shapes; one end is fixed on the secondary off line 5; the other end extends to the upper end of riddle 13, the material that auxiliary thresher 5 is deviate from can be slipped on the riddle 13 to sieve.The next door of auxiliary thresher 5 have with auxiliary thresher 5 on impurity discharging port 7 corresponding sifters 10; the slide plate of a face of slope also is installed in the lower end of sifter 10; extend to riddle 13 above, the material that sifter 10 can be sieved is sent into riddle 13 once more and is sieved.
Its course of work is:
After the engine starting, in conjunction with operative clutch, treat machine running steadily after, by conveying plant corncob is tilted to and is fed into the threshing hopper, enter the corncob of main sheller unit, carrying out threshing between spike-tooth frontal impact, side extruding, the corncob and under the kneading action between the notch board.Seed of taking off and tiny clever chaff pass the notch board eyelet, and in dropping process, tiny clever chaff is blown out outside the machine by blower fan, and seed passes sieve aperture, slide to winnow, are thrown and raise pack through slide plate; Not full or a small amount of broken seed sieves from coming out through the 3rd.Axially entered secondary sheller unit by the corncob taken off through main impurity discharging port, what will not purify carries out the secondary threshing.The eyelet that seed of being taken off and tiny clever chaff pass the auxiliary cylinder notch board, sliding to main separated sieve through slide plate separates, thick assorted surplusly be discharged on the sifter through tangential impurity discharging port at auxiliary cylinder one end, tiny assorted surplus and seed passes sieve aperture, slide to main sieve by slide plate and clean, corncob is outside pair sieve discharge machine.
